Description

Description

Ultimately, what happens with our parenting behavior? Is it something we decide upon when we become parents - or even before that? Many of us - especially those who did not have a good experience with their own parents - often say: 'I will raise my children completely differently!'. But is that easy? Can we make a purely conscious decision now and actually behave that way when 'the pots are boiling' inside us, caused by a completely silly - to us - stubbornness of our child?

'I couldn't believe I would say to my child what my parents said to me...', wondered a parent, when he was startled by his outburst of anger due to his little son's provocative behavior. Is our parenting behavior 'built' long before we have what we call 'Consciousness'?

This is what the authors of this book reveal, opening the 'door' to our own early childhood - so that we can judge, and if necessary reshape our parenting behavior, for the sake of our shared life with our children.

NOTE: On page 4, there is the authors' approval for dividing their work into 2 BOOKS in the Greek edition. And on page 34, titled 'Note of the Greek Edition', we explain why the parent does NOT need to acquire the SECOND BOOK of this work, with the findings of the neuroscience of the brain, and their bibliography.

[Excerpt from the text on the back cover of the edition]
